Overview

Tellurian Inc. in Madison, Wisconsin, stands out with its unique integration of mental health and substance use disorder treatments. They offer a full continuum of care, including detoxification, residential treatment, outpatient services, and transitional housing. Their specialized programs cater to diverse populations, including veterans and those with co-occurring disorders. The facility's dedicated staff, many of whom are in recovery themselves, bring a personal touch to the treatment process, fostering a compassionate and understanding environment. Tellurian's commitment to individualized care and community support makes it a compelling option for those seeking a comprehensive and empathetic approach to recovery. Low-cost facility ($): Affordable or free with insurance. Payment assistance likely available.

  • Location:

    2914 Industrial Drive , Madison, WI 53713 Directions

  • Ages Served: Youth (Ages 12-17)
  • Treatment Setting: Residential inpatient, Hospital inpatient, Telemedicine, Detox
  • Medication-assisted Treatment: None listed
  • Detox For: Opioids, Alcohol, Benzodiazepines, Cocaine, Methamphetamines
  • Available Services: Transitional services, Recovery support services, Treats alcohol use disorder, Treats opioid use disorder, Mental health treatment
  • Special Programs: Service members, Adult men, Adult women, Court referrals, LGBTQ, Military families, Past domestic violence, Past sexual abuse, Past trauma, Mental health disorders, HIV/AIDS, Pregnant/postpartum, Veterans, Pain management
  • Languages Served: Sign language, English
